Transferring assets with XRP

XRP is like a bridge to other currencies. The XRP payment protocol is used not only for XRP transactions but also the transfer of money in any form, fiat or crypto. Any currency can be exchanged for another one. Unlike Bitcoin, XRP has lower processing times and lower costs.
